Pool Supplies: How to Compare Prices Before Opening Day

Pool supplies price comparison saves serious cash before season opens. Learn how to compare prices on chemicals, equipment, and replacement parts.

Pool supplies price comparison is a sneaky money-saver. The local pool store is convenient but often 30-50% above online options for the exact same chlorine. Multiply that by a season of supplies and you're looking at hundreds in savings.

Where the Big Markups Live

  • Chlorine tablets: $90 at the pool store vs $60 online for the same 25-lb bucket.
  • Shock packs: Often double the per-pound cost in-store.
  • Test strips: Brand-name vs equivalent: $20 vs $8 for the same chemistry.
  • Pump and filter parts: OEM-branded items vs generic-equivalent O-rings and baskets.

Where to Compare

  1. InTheSwim, PoolSupplyWorld, Leslie's, Amazon: Same SKU, often 20-40% spread.
  2. Sam's Club and Costco: Bulk chemicals at warehouse pricing.
  3. Local pool store: Useful for water tests and on-the-spot help; pricier for product.

Buy in Bulk Pre-Season

Chemicals are cheapest in March-April before demand spikes. Stock a full season of chlorine, shock, and stabilizer in one order. Storage cost is zero; price savings are 20-30%.

Don't Skip the Free Water Test

Most local pool stores offer free water testing. Bring a sample, get a printout, then buy chemicals online instead of from the recommendation list. You get expert diagnosis plus the best price.
